How to fill out fixture unit form for

How to fill out fixture unit form for:
01
Start by gathering all the necessary information such as the type of fixtures being used, the quantity of each fixture, and the corresponding fixture unit values.
02
Next, carefully review the requirements and guidelines provided by the relevant authority or organization requesting the fixture unit form. Ensure that you understand the specific details and instructions.
03
Begin filling out the form by entering the required personal or project information, such as your name, address, contact details, and the project location.
04
Proceed to list the different types of fixtures that will be installed. Common fixtures may include toilets, sinks, showers, bathtubs, and urinals. Specify the quantity of each fixture.
05
For each fixture, input the corresponding fixture unit value as recommended by plumbing codes or regulations. Fixture unit values are typically assigned based on the fixture's flow rate and drainage requirements. You can obtain these values from plumbing codebooks or your local plumbing authorities.
06
Multiply the quantity of each fixture by its corresponding fixture unit value and input the calculated total fixture unit for each fixture on the form.
07
If the fixture unit form requires additional information, such as drawings or plans, make sure to include them as instructed.
08
Double-check all the information and calculations provided on the form to ensure accuracy and completeness.
09
Once you have filled out all the necessary sections of the form, review it one final time to ensure there are no errors or omissions.
10
Submit the completed fixture unit form to the appropriate party or authority as specified.

What is fixture unit form for?
The fixture unit form is used to determine the water supply demands for a building or structure based on the number and type of plumbing fixtures it contains.
Who is required to file fixture unit form for?
The fixture unit form must be filed by architects, engineers, or plumbers who are responsible for designing or modifying the plumbing system of a building or structure.
How to fill out fixture unit form for?
The fixture unit form should be filled out by providing information about the types and quantities of plumbing fixtures in the building or structure, as well as other relevant details about the plumbing system.
What is the purpose of fixture unit form for?
The purpose of the fixture unit form is to ensure that the water supply system of a building can adequately meet the demands of its plumbing fixtures, in terms of water flow rates and pressure.
What information must be reported on fixture unit form for?
The fixture unit form requires reporting the types and quantities of plumbing fixtures, their fixture units values, the number of stories in the building, and other essential details about the plumbing system.
